Response Compression

Eliminate response bloat to save 200-400 tokens per response while maintaining clarity.

When To Use

  • Reducing verbose output to save context tokens
  • Providing concise answers without losing information

When NOT To Use

  • Educational explanations where detail improves understanding
  • First-time setup instructions needing step-by-step clarity

Elimination Rules

ELIMINATE

| Category | Examples | Replacement |

|----------|----------|-------------|

| Decorative Emojis | -- | (remove entirely) |

| Filler Words | "just", "simply", "basically", "essentially" | (remove or rephrase) |

| Hedging Language | "might", "could", "perhaps", "potentially", "I think" | Use factual statements |

| Hype Words | "powerful", "amazing", "seamless", "robust", "elegant" | Use precise descriptors |

| Conversational Framing | "Let's dive in", "Now that we've", "Moving forward" | Start with content |

| Transitions | "Furthermore", "Additionally", "In conclusion" | (remove, use structure) |

| Call-to-Action | "Feel free to", "Don't hesitate to", "Let me know if" | (remove from endings) |

PRESERVE (When Appropriate)

| Category | Example | When to Use |

|----------|---------|-------------|

| Status Indicators | [pass] [fail] [warn] | In structured output, checklists |

| Technical Precision | Exact error messages | When debugging |

| Safety Warnings | Critical info about data loss | Always preserve |

| Context Setting | Brief necessary background | When user lacks context |

Before/After Transformations

Example 1: Opening Bloat

Before (68 tokens):

Great question! I'd be happy to help you understand how this works.
The bloat detector is a powerful tool that analyzes your codebase
and provides comprehensive insights into potential issues...

After (28 tokens):

The bloat detector analyzes codebases using three tiers: quick scan
(heuristics), static analysis (tools), and deep audit (git history).

Example 2: Closing Bloat

Before (45 tokens):

I've completed the task. Here's what I did:
- Deleted 5 files
- Saved 18k tokens

Next steps:
1. Review the changes
2. Run tests
3. Commit if satisfied

Let me know if you need anything else!

After (15 tokens):

Done. Deleted 5 files, saved 18k tokens.
Backup: backup/unbloat-20260102

Example 3: Hedging Removal

Before:

I think this might potentially be causing the issue, but I could be wrong.
Perhaps we should consider looking into it further.

After:

This causes the issue. Investigate the connection pool timeout setting.

Termination Guidelines

When to Stop

End response immediately after:

  • Delivering requested information
  • Completing requested task
  • Providing necessary context

Avoid Trailing Content

| Pattern | Action |

|---------|--------|

| "Next steps:" | Remove unless safety-critical |

| "Let me know if..." | Remove always |

| "Summary:" | Remove (user has the response) |

| "Hope this helps!" | Remove always |

| Bullet recaps | Remove (redundant) |

Override: action-first-output

When Skill(conserve:action-first-output) is active, two rows above

are overridden:

  • "Next steps:": one single-line next action is required, not

removed. The ban still holds for multi-item "Next steps:" blocks.

  • Bullet recaps: a position marker ("step 3 of 5 done") is

required every turn. The ban still holds for recapping content the

reader just read.

See the Precedence table in that skill for the full resolution.

Exceptions (When Summaries Help)

  • Multi-part tasks with many changes
  • User explicitly requests summary
  • Critical rollback/backup information
  • Complex debugging with multiple findings

Directness Guidelines

Direct =/= Rude

Goal: Information density, not coldness.

| Eliminate | Preserve |

|-----------|----------|

| Unnecessary encouragement | Technical context |

| Rapport-building filler | Safety warnings |

| Hedging without reason | Necessary explanations |

| Positive padding | Factual uncertainty markers |

Encouragement Bloat

Eliminate:

  • "Great question!"
  • "Excellent point!"
  • "Good thinking!"
  • "That's a great approach!"

Replace with: Direct answers to the question.

Rapport-Building Filler

Eliminate:

  • "I'd be happy to help you..."
  • "Feel free to ask if..."
  • "I hope this helps!"
  • "Let me know if you need..."

Replace with: Useful information or nothing.

Preserve Helpful Directness

The following are NOT bloat:

  • Brief context when user needs it
  • Clarifying questions when ambiguity affects correctness
  • Warnings about destructive operations
  • Error explanations that help debugging

Quick Reference Checklist

Before finalizing response:

  • [ ] No decorative emojis (status indicators OK)
  • [ ] No filler words (just, simply, basically)
  • [ ] No hedging without technical uncertainty
  • [ ] No hype words (powerful, amazing, robust)
  • [ ] No conversational framing at start
  • [ ] No unnecessary transitions
  • [ ] No "let me know" or "feel free" closings
  • [ ] No summary of what was just said
  • [ ] No "next steps" unless safety-critical
  • [ ] Ends after delivering value

Token Impact

| Pattern | Typical Savings |

|---------|-----------------|

| Eliminating opening bloat | 30-50 tokens |

| Removing closing fluff | 20-40 tokens |

| Cutting filler words | 10-20 tokens |

| Removing emoji | 5-15 tokens |

| Direct answers | 50-100 tokens |

| Total per response | 150-350 tokens |

Over 1000 responses: 150k-350k tokens saved.

Exit Criteria

  • [ ] Response contains none of the banned openers: "Great question!",

"I'd be happy to help", "Let's dive in", "Furthermore",

"Additionally", "In conclusion"

  • [ ] Response contains no trailing filler: "Let me know if...",

"Feel free to...", "Hope this helps!", "Next steps:" (unless

safety-critical)

  • [ ] Token count of final response is 150-400 tokens lower than a

naive version of the same content would be, verified by comparing

before/after examples when token impact is measurable

  • [ ] Safety warnings, technical precision, and factual uncertainty

markers are preserved intact; only decorative and conversational

content is removed
